What is Semaglutide?

Semaglutide is a glucagon-like peptide-1 (GLP-1) receptor agonist at first developed for handling type 2 diabetes. It imitates the function of the GLP-1 hormone, which is associated with regulating hunger, insulin secretion, and glucose metabolism. Recently, research has actually unveiled its capacity for considerable weight reduction, causing its approval for weight management in people with weight problems or obese conditions.

How Does Semaglutide Work?

Semaglutide works by:

  1. Reducing Appetite: It indicates the brain to boost sensations of fullness, therefore decreasing general calorie intake.
  2. Slowing Gastric Emptying: By delaying the digestion procedure, it contributes to extended feelings of satiety.
  3. Improving Insulin Sensitivity: Semaglutide improves the body's ability to react to insulin, helping manage blood glucose levels more effectively.

Efficiency of Semaglutide in Weight Loss

Scientific trials have demonstrated that semaglutide can cause substantial weight reduction in people fighting with weight problems. In a pivotal study, participants utilizing semaglutide experienced an average weight-loss of around 15% of their body weight over 68 weeks compared to those on a placebo.

Who Should Consider Semaglutide?

Semaglutide is mostly recommended for:

  1. Individuals with a BMI of 30 or greater: Classified as obese.
  2. People with a BMI of 27 or higher: Accompanied by weight-related medical conditions such as hypertension or type 2 diabetes.

List of Considerations Before Use

  • Case history: Individuals ought to talk to their doctor regarding any individual or family history of pancreatitis or thyroid cancer.
  • Comorbid Conditions: Evaluation of diabetes, heart diseases, or kidney concerns is essential before beginning treatment.
  • Weight Reduction Goals: Setting realistic and sustainable weight-loss goals with a health care professional can optimize outcomes.

Common Side Effects

  • Nausea
  • Diarrhea
  • Vomiting
  • Constipation
  • Abdominal discomfort

Serious Side Effects

Although rare, some severe concerns might arise, consisting of:

  • Pancreatitis
  • Gallbladder disease
  • Kidney issues
  • Thyroid tumors (in animal research studies)

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. The length of time does it take to see results with semaglutide?

Results can be viewed as early as the very first few weeks, but considerable weight-loss typically occurs over several months of constant usage.

2. Can semaglutide be used long-lasting?

Yes, semaglutide is approved for long-lasting use in weight management. Constant tracking by doctor ensures its efficacy and safety with time.

3. Is semaglutide proper for everyone?

No, semaglutide is not suitable for everyone. Pregnant or breastfeeding people, and those with a history of particular medical conditions need to consult their doctor.

4. Will I restore weight after stopping semaglutide?

As with any weight-loss treatment, stopping semaglutide might result in weight restore if healthy lifestyle routines are not maintained. It's important to continue a balanced diet plan and workout program.
